The role holder will provide ceremonial front of house funeral duties which will be of a high quality, customer focused, flexible and with an attention to detail. These duties will include Chapel Door attendant, attending interments, scatterings and linked services.
Role outcomes
 Ceremonial duties to include
receiving the funeral cortege,
family and mourners and usher
into the chapel. This also
includes traffic management.
(50%)
 Members of the public, funeral
directors, clergy, celebrants and
contractors are assisted with
their enquiries and activities.
(30%)
 Sites and buildings are open and
available during operating hours
(5%)
 Audio visual equipment is
checked on a regular basis
throughout the day (5%)
 Chapel, Waiting Room, Toilets
and Book of Remembrance
Rooms are well maintained and
safe for mourners and other
visitors throughout the day. (5%)
 Displaying floral tributes in the
flower viewing area throughout
the day. (5%)
